11. General Purpose I/O
The general purpose I/O pads can be configured to act in three
different ways:
input
output
alternate function (internally controlled)
Input pads can be read; they report the digital value (high or
low) present on the pad at the read time.
Output pads can only be written or queried and set the value
of the pad output.
An alternate function pad is internally controlled by the
GE866-QUAD firmware and acts depending on the function
implemented.
For Logic levels please refer to chapter 8.
